Comprehending Common Types of Residential Glass Damage

Residential glass can sustain damage in various methods, and recognizing the type and severity of the problem is the primary step toward a suitable service. Comprehending these distinctions helps property owners communicate successfully with repair experts and set reasonable expectations for the result.

Impact damage represents among the most frequent reasons for glass repair needs. This occurs when things strike glass surfaces, leaving fractures, chips, or total breaks. The size and pattern of the damage usually expose the force and instructions of the impact, which professionals use to assess whether repair is feasible or replacement is essential.

Thermal tension cracks establish when glass experiences considerable temperature variations across its surface. These fractures frequently appear as lines that start at the edge of the glass and move inward, sometimes following unexpected patterns. Unlike impact damage, thermal tension normally shows an installation concern or issue with the window frame instead of external force.

Spontaneous glass breakage sometimes takes place in tempered glass, especially in big panels or those with imperfections in the glass composition. While fairly rare, this phenomenon underscores the value of expert evaluation for any glass damage, as the underlying causes may not be right away obvious.

Ecological damage incorporates damage brought on by weather condition events, settling structures, or steady wear. Hail storms can crater glass surface areas, while foundation settling might put tension on窗口 frames in manner ins which compromise glass stability. Salt air in coastal areas can likewise harm window seals and frames in time, resulting in fogging or seal failure in double-pane windows.

When to Repair Versus Replace

Figuring out whether glass can be fixed or needs complete replacement depends on several factors that property owners should understand. The decision effects both cost and long-lasting efficiency, making it a crucial consideration.

Repair is normally feasible when the damage consists of small chips or fractures determining less than a particular length-- usually around the size of a dollar expense for cracks. The place of the damage likewise matters considerably; fractures near the edge of a pane frequently compromise structural stability more seriously than those at the center. Additionally, the type of glass impacts repair options, as single-pane windows are more uncomplicated to repair than contemporary double or triple-pane assemblies.

Replacement ends up being the required option when damage is extensive, when there are multiple impact points, or when the structural integrity of the window has actually been compromised. Misting in between panes-- indicating seal failure-- normally requires complete system replacement instead of repair, as the sealed assembly can not be effectively resealed in place. Similarly, tempered glass that has actually been damaged can not be fixed and need to be replaced completely, as the tempering procedure makes any attempt to spot the glass both inadequate and possibly hazardous.

The Residential Glass Repair Process

Expert glass repair follows a systematic process created to make sure safety, quality, and client fulfillment. Understanding this procedure helps house owners prepare for service and value the knowledge needed for appropriate repair.

The preliminary evaluation phase includes a comprehensive assessment of the damage, the surrounding frame, and the overall condition of the setup. Professionals look for additional damage that might not be immediately noticeable, assess the frame's condition, and figure out whether repair is appropriate or replacement is needed. This assessment likewise recognizes any safety issues, such as jeopardized glass in door panels or near children's backyard.

For glass replacement, the procedure starts with mindful elimination of the damaged glass, consisting of thorough cleansing of the frame to remove old glazing substance, seals, or debris. The brand-new glass is then exactly determined and cut to fit the existing frame, accounting for any variations in the opening. Setup involves using proper glazing materials, guaranteeing appropriate seating of the glass, and sealing all edges to avoid air and water seepage.

Repair strategies for small damage normally involve injecting specialized resins into cracks or chips, followed by curing under ultraviolet light. This process brings back structural stability and optical clarity to damaged locations, though the outcomes depend greatly on the ability of the technician and the quality of products used. The repaired location is then polished to lessen exposure of the damage.

Often Asked Questions About Residential Glass Repair

How long does residential glass repair generally take?

Many standard window repairs take between one to 3 hours from arrival to completion. Replacement jobs for basic windows can often be completed in a single check out. Custom or specialized glass might need ordering and lead times of numerous days to weeks, depending on specs and supplier availability.

Will my homeowner's insurance cover glass repair?

Many property owner's insurance coverage cover glass damage from abrupt, unintentional causes such as storms or vandalism. Policies typically exclude damage from typical wear and tear or property owner carelessness. Evaluation your specific policy or call your insurance coverage supplier to comprehend protection for your circumstance before initiating repair.

Can glass be repaired when it has totally shattered?

When glass has shattered into numerous pieces, repair is normally not possible. The cost and intricacy of reassembling fragmented glass exceed the advantages, and structural stability can not be reliably restored. Complete replacement is the proper solution for shattered glass.

What causes fogging between window panes?

Misting suggests seal failure in double or triple-pane windows. The seal that keeps the inert gas fill and avoids condensation has actually broken, enabling moisture invasion in between the panes. This can not be repaired successfully; the whole insulated glass system needs replacement.

Is it safe to leave a split window unrepaired?

Little fractures in non-critical areas can in some cases wait for hassle-free repair timing, but significant cracks compromise window integrity and energy performance. Fractures can spread out rapidly with temperature level changes, stress, or vibration. Short-lived measures such as covering the fracture from both sides with tape can avoid more dispersing up until expert repair is obtained.
